A member asked:

Why do i have runny nose whenever i have meals?

7 doctors weighed in across 2 answers

Food allergy: One may have a food allergy or a reflex known as gustatory rhinorrhea.

Rhinitis: The medical term is gustatory rhinitis. It is extremely common. When you eat your body goes into a secretory state. You saliva glands secrete saliva, pancreas secretes digestive chemicals the stomach secretes and the gall bladder secretes. Your nose is just another part of the body that has something to secrete and in this case it's mucus. If it is really bothersome medications can control it.
